The other incentive for Nintendo to not want to cut the Switch price is they can transition to Switch 2 easier if Switch OLED remains at $350 ... that means if Switch 2 shows up for say ... $399.99 ... that's not a big jump from the price people already are accustomed to paying.

Just like PS4 Pro was $399.99 with no price cuts and then Sony launched PS5 at $399.99 (disc less in limited quantities) and $499.99 (w/disc).
